 Sales Compensation Analyst - Hyderabad

Job Description

PRIMARY OBJECTIVE(S):

  • Leads best-in-class sales compensation processes and activities to enable sales compensation to be a driver to support business objectives.
  • Meets operational performance objectives, identifies, executes on ideas that allow for continuous improvement in existing processes.
  • Works collaboratively within Clarivate s unified Commercial Operations team and with key external stakeholders from sales to ensure departmental objectives are met.
K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:

Key Activities

Sales Compensation Plan Design Execution

  • Active participant working collaboratively with Commercial Planning, Analytics Reporting team on transforming Business Unit ( BU ) revenue/sales plan target into sales plan goals by territory and individual.
  • Provide consultation on milestone requirements to ensure timely and quality execution of overall Clarivate compensation calendar, including plan reviews, and managing key milestones according to plan targets.
  • Work with management to engage with the business at the onset and throughout the plan design including managing focus groups to ensure business feedback is incorporated in plan design.
  • Provide analytical support to determine key performance measures and plan design; have a deep understanding of how sales works and how incentive compensation drives behaviors.
  • Support sales management and Finance via financial modeling and scenario analysis to support the advocacy of incentive plan roll-out and communications.
  • Create, draft and develop the compensation plan by ensuring the proper controls are in place in management of these plans.

Special Incentive Plan ( SPIFF ) Design Execution

  • Understand business requirements and provide support to Business or Sales SVP for modelling and partnering with Finance for special incentives SPIFFs or plan modifications during the year.
  • Manage the SPIFFs including communication and roll-out.

Commission Processing Payment

  • Work collaboratively with the commissions team and have a direct impact on claim validation processes.
  • Lead the collection and validation of performance data. This represents the aggregate compensation data validated by commission processing team to perform compensation analysis.
  • Manage compensation calculation activities which include calculating amount of incentive compensation due to each sales individual for each period. Ensure enough audit trails, reconciliations and validation processes are in place to minimize errors. Includes maintenance and storage of period calculations/templates
  • Set-up necessary controls for adjustment management. Documenting approvals and ensuring audit trail for adjustments.
  • System Support Maintenance- Managing tools, forms and systems required to handle compensation calculation.
  • Handle preliminary and final communications to distribute results of compensation analysis to sales for review and to commission processing team for payment.

Advocacy Field Support

  • Answer individual questions about the compensation plan or compensation treatment. Research and validate relief request. Respond in timely, professional manner to ensure internal satisfaction is high and deliver customer delight .
  • Acts as level 2 escalation support for commission specialist team for their related queries that this team cannot resolve.

Reporting Analysis

  • Delivery of standard performance reporting by individual by performance metric for each period. Ensure reporting is provided to each level of sales management including addressing Winner s Circle and Sales Awards reporting requirement.
  • Ad-Hoc Performance/Sales Mgmt Reporting: Provide analytical and ad-hoc support to sales management for advanced/periodic needs; includes evaluating effectiveness of new performance metrics, SPIFFs, etc.
  • Reporting Capabilities: Develop Clarivate standardized reporting package and systems tools to use. Provide support to ensure this is aligned with business and IC priorities.
  • Forecasting for Sales Commission Expense: Partner with Finance to determine projected performance and resulting commission expense forecast.

Policy, Process Quality Management

  • Policy Development - Support development of standard policies procedures for managing new hires (ramp-ups, and guarantees), leave coverage, open territory coverage, etc.
  • Ensure adherence to company risk policy and enforce internal controls within all processing in conjunction with local statutory and labor requirements.
  • Process Changes: Constantly evaluate current process and making recommendations for improvement, standardization and tools. Identify and execute on ideas to drive process improvement
  • Participate actively in change management efforts to implement Clarivate better practices, new processes process and improvements in systems and tools.
